Two Point Charges Astride an Infinite Line Charge: An infinite line charge of uniform charge density +Po lies on the z-axis. Two negative point charges lie on opposite sides of the line as shown. Suppose the point charges are constrained to move along an axis perpendicular to the line charge as shown. Find the equilibrium values of ₁ and ₂ that minimizes the total energy. Recall that n the potential of a line charge is (Peo/27 ) Inr. PEO TO
